Q3 Planning Note — Velmara Instruments

Heads of department: the joint venture proposal with Kestrin Fabrication is moving ahead. Terms: 60/40 split, shared tooling at the Norwick site, launch targeted for spring. Resourcing asks due by Friday. No external discussion until signing. The strategic rationale, confidential to this group, is set out below.

board note of fadug-yafog: Only 39 of the 474 pilot accounts renewed Belion, so a churn review is set for September 6. Wenixax Logistics is in early talks to buy Gorirek Systems for about $270.9 million.

## Runbook: Cron drift on Tickwright

Welcome aboard! If the nightly Tickwright jobs start firing late, first check NTP sync on the scheduler hosts — drift over 30s is the usual culprit. Compare the host clock against the Meridian time service before blaming the job code. If drift is confirmed, restart chronyd and re-run the missed jobs manually via the Tickwright admin endpoint. Note the admin endpoint requires auth since last quarter's hardening pass. The key you'll need for those manual re-runs is below.

gateway credential: kto23_LX9A4ys6i4nzHtpOLNLodKK

Migration Step 4: Enabling Offline Mode for TerraCount

Before flipping the offline flag, verify that the sync queue on the Brellview staging cluster is fully drained. Surveyors in the Halden Flats pilot will lose any unsynced plots if you skip this. Run the drain check twice, ten minutes apart, and confirm zero pending rows both times. Then update the sync-worker config so it points at the new consolidated store rather than the legacy shard. Use the following connection string for the consolidated store.

warehouse DSN: mssql://rusdor_svc:0FSWCn9@db-951a.paliqforge.local:5432/ulawyn

## Local Setup

We're carving the user module out of the Brindlewood monolith into its own service, `userette`. For local runs, you'll boot both side by side — the monolith still owns sessions, while `userette` handles profiles and preferences. Run `make seed-users` first or everything will 404 at you. The service expects a dedicated Postgres database rather than the monolith's shared one, so configure it with the connection string below.

primary connection of yagep-kahip = redis://giliel_svc:zYiKsLL2PLpfPL@db-348f.xolmarsys.corp:5432/fenwyn